On October 12 2013 04:38 NarutO wrote: I don't see any reason to bash Flash here. He barely made mistakes. Against a Templar opening there isn't really a lot you can do, especially considering its BelShir which is very straight forward. Drops can only come from one side and attacks at the third base can be deflected quiet good as well.
Maybe people who have no clue about Terran or Protoss or the match up in particular should stop bashing players. State was ahead because the general opening allowed him to be save, get his third base up regardless and Flash couldn't really do shit. Usually if you cannot put down aggression against Protoss and deal no damage whatsoever, it results in Protoss being ahead, if you wasn't greedy to begin with.
Thats why he 'struggled' yet when you saw the fight, even though State fucked up, Flash still won convincingly, when he should not have won like that.
